What to consider before buying

Consider your putting stroke type (straight vs. arc) and preferred head shape (blade vs. mallet) when choosing. Higher MOI mallets offer more forgiveness, while blades provide better feel. Test the grip size and weight for comfort. Budget options can perform well but may lack premium features. Always check the club length and lie angle for proper fit.
